本地传输网光缆紧缺场景的解决方案探讨  被引量:3

摘  要:随着5G业务的布局、传送网的链路扩容、光纤线路租用等爆发式需求,对本地的传输业务带来了巨大的基础建设压力,而通过新建管道布局基础光缆难以追赶业务的快速发展,且新建OTN设备也过于消耗集团投资。针对以上问题,通过对比传统解决光缆资源紧缺的方案,探讨新型更高效的光缆资源紧缺的解决方案,并提供了几种典型的缺缆场景的应用,为未来5G建设时期的发展提出了本地网传输侧的应对策略。The explosive demand for 5G services deployment, hnk expansion of transmission networks, and lease of optical fiber lines brings tremendous infrastructure pressure on local transmission services. However, it is difficult to catch up with the rapid development of the business via the new pipeline layout of basic optical cable, and again the new OTN equipment would be also very expensive for the group's investment. In response to the above problems, the traditional solutions to scarce cable resources are compared, and some new and more efficient solutions for fiber optic cable shortages explored. Finally, several typical cabledeficient scenarios are provided, and the coping strategies of the local network transmission side for the future development of 5G construction period also proposed.
